My Father being the Root 06/09/2024

I used to watch my father lace his shoes, crisp white shirt perfectly tucked in, walking out the door to serve the same company for over three decades.

He was like a monument to loyalty, an antiquity of an era where hard work, discipline, and consistency were the only currencies worth anything.

But me? I’m a product of a different time.

I’ve been in over 79 jobs, not even my father had reached that many years, he’s alive & well though. Not once have I lasted longer than nine months, the shortest time I’ve spent in a job was a day and a half selling Appliances Insurance for the UK Senior Citizens. I move from one position to the next, never staying, never committing.

At first, it bothered me — a sense of guilt from not becoming the man my father raised.

But then, I realized something: loyalty today feels like a slow death.

You devote your time, energy, and soul to a corporate machine, only to be forgotten the moment you walk out.

Dogs should be loyal to their masters. People should be loyal to themselves.

My dad — charming, articulate, always well-composed — was the epitome of a man who mastered the art of sales. I, on the other hand, turned out to be more of a manipulator, a hustler.

My game was different. I was never afraid to charm my way out of things, get what I wanted no matter the consequences, especially with women. In a world where everyone & everything wants to control you, I decided to be the one pulling the strings.

I love my father deeply. Everything I know, everything I’ve built, comes from the foundation he laid.

He taught me the importance of knowledge, drilled it into my bones. While he reads a book every 2–3 days, I consume them like air — reading more than a book a day, sometimes. But unlike him, I write. I pour out over a 1000 words every day. He gave me the roots, and I became the fruit.

And I learned from him, not in words but through his sacrifices, that the only person you should be loyal to is the one in the mirror.

Blood, sweat, and tears — they’re part of the equation. But the world has changed.

The old game? It’s a sucker’s bet. I’d rather take risks, move faster, fall harder, and get back up again.

Loyalty isn’t what builds legacies anymore — creativity, adaptability, and knowing when to walk away are.
